A high level Parliamentary panel has said that as the second wave of the Coronavirus pandemic "even more vigorously ripped the economy, particularly the micro small and medium (MSME) sector", the Centre's stimulus package for economic revival has proved to be "inadequate". A Parliament Standing Committee, comprising MPs of parties that have been vehemently opposing the three new farm laws, has asked for implementation of Essential Commodities (Amendment) Act, 2020 — one of the three controversial laws — in “letter and spirit”. Despite the Centre and various state governments announcing several initiatives to attract multinationals looking to shift base outside China post-Covid-19 pandemic, India has been left behind by countries like Vietnam, Taiwan and Thailand, which have emerged as the preferred destinations for most such companies. The Parliamentary Standing Committee on Health and Family Welfare had flagged the issue of inadequate supply of oxygen and 'grossly inadequate' government hospital beds in November 2020 and asked the central government to take immediate action in view of the COVID-19 pandemic.
